As President-elect Donald Trump prepares for his second term in office, companies across the US. are generously contributing to his inauguration fund. With just days remaining until the highly anticipated event on January 20, 2025, several prominent corporations from the tech, automotive, and aerospace industries have pledged substantial donations.

Below are the major donors leading the charge.

Amazon’s $1 Million Commitment

Amazon, the global e-commerce leader founded by Jeff Bezos, has committed $1 million to the 2025 inauguration. Along with the donation, Amazon’s Prime Video will offer a live-stream of the event, ensuring widespread access for viewers around the world. Google Contributes $1 Million

Under the leadership of Sundar Pichai, Google has also donated $1 million to Trump’s inauguration fund. As a tech giant facing ongoing anti-trust litigation, Google’s financial support is notable. The company has pledged to provide a live-stream of the event on YouTube, making it accessible to millions of viewers globally. Boeing Pledges $1 Million

The aerospace industry is represented by Boeing, which has donated $1 million to the inauguration fund. Known for its bipartisan support of U.S. presidential inaugurations, Boeing’s contribution highlights its commitment to supporting national events, regardless of political affiliation. Record-Breaking Fundraising Effort

With over $200 million already raised for the 2025 inauguration, Trump’s campaign has set a new fundraising record. This amount far exceeds the $62 million raised for Joe Biden’s 2021 inauguration and reflects the immense backing from corporate donors.
